直樹

なおき

Naoki

NAH-oh-kee · a male name

Straight + living tree

Honest · Upright · Enduring

Given by Shiromine

The story of Naoki

The definitive Naoki — a tree that grew straight.

Naoki has been trusted across generations — the 'nao' means straight and honest, the 'ki' a living tree. A name that keeps its word.

Kanji by kanji

straight, honest

The kanji of what is straight and true — in lines and in people.

living tree

Not just wood but a standing, growing tree — rooted life reaching upward.

About 直樹

直樹 is integrity as botany: grow tall, grow straight, give shade. One of the most quietly respected spellings in Japanese naming.

Popularity in Japan

Strong through the Showa and Heisei eras, Naoki still reads as solid and current.

Through the decades

1970s1980s1990s

A byword for dependable men across three decades.

Deep dive

Japanese praises honest people as massugu — straight, like a well-grown trunk. Naoki plants that virtue and lets it grow rings.
